Air Wales cutting flights
 
More cutbacks at the Red Dragon. No flights will operate from Plymouth after 19 February, Paris (Beauvais) down to 3 a week (and the route has not even started yet), Exeter-Cork to operate only twice weekly. Also rumours of the fleet reducing to just 3x ATR42's. Feel sorry for the guys and gals there, it must feel like death by a thousand cuts.

WOWBOY 9th Feb 2006 16:51

Air Wales are also stopping the NCL-ABZ part of the route at the same time!!!

It will now just be Cardiff-Newcastle, before it was Plymouth-Cradiff-Newastle-Aberdeen so they are cutting the extened routes to Aberdeen and Plymouth!!!

Exeter-Cork will operate 2weekly as said before on MON and FRI
Newquay-Cork will operate 3 weekly on TUES, WED and SUN

Cardiff-Paris Beauvias will operste on WED,SAT and SUN
